Fields Medals Awarded to Deng, Pardon, Tsimerman and Wang at ICM in Philadelphia

Their proofs settle long‑standing problems that reshape links between physics, geometry and number theory.

Overview

  • The International Mathematical Union formally awarded the 2026 Fields Medals on Thursday at the International Congress of Mathematicians in Philadelphia to Yu Deng, John Pardon, Jacob Tsimerman and Hong Wang.
  • Yu Deng was cited for deriving the Boltzmann equation from Newtonian particle dynamics, a major step on Hilbert’s sixth problem about placing physics on a firm mathematical footing.
  • Hong Wang, working with Joshua Zahl, received recognition for a proof of the three‑dimensional Kakeya conjecture and is the youngest of this year’s winners and the third woman ever to win a Fields Medal.
  • John Pardon was honored for key advances in geometry and topology, including work on knot distortion tied to a conjecture of Gromov, and Jacob Tsimerman was recognized for a proof of the André–Oort conjecture that does not rely on the Riemann hypothesis.
  • The awards followed two organizational issues: a machine‑readable leak of winners on the conference website that was removed before the ceremony, and a petition with withdrawals by several national societies over U.S. hosting and visa concerns, neither of which stopped the prize announcements or their wide international attention.
